Abstract
Power optimization in a medical implant based system. A method includes receiving a portion of a signal by a first transceiver. The method further includes determining, from the portion of the signal, a time duration after which a subsequent portion of the signal will be transmitted. The subsequent portion is transmitted at end of the portion. The method also includes entering into an inactive state for the time duration.

13. A method for signaling in a medical implant based system, the method comprising:
-
modifying transmission time of a signal based on a time uncertainty between a first transceiver and a second transceiver by the second transceiver; and waking up, by the first transceiver, at a predefined time according to a clock of the first transceiver to detect the signal. - View Dependent Claims (14, 15, 16, 17)

18. A system comprising:
a medical implant transceiver comprising a radio frequency receiver that receives a portion of a signal; and a physical layer circuit responsive to the portion of the signal to determine a time duration, from the portion of the signal, after which a subsequent portion of the signal will be transmitted, the subsequent portion being transmitted at end of the portion, cause the medical implant transceiver to enter into an inactive state for the time duration, and awaken the medical implant transceiver after the time duration has elapsed. - View Dependent Claims (19, 20)
